KE-E: PUBLIC
COMPLAINTS
Complaint
Procedure
(1) A
parent, guardian, or other person or group who believes that M.G.L. c. 76, s. 5
or 603 CMR 26.00 has been or is being violated, may request a written statement
of the reasons therefore from the responsible School Committee through the
Superintendent and may submit a copy of such request to the Bureau of Equal
Educational Opportunity of the Department of Education. If such request is made,
a copy of such request shall be sent by the School Committee to the Bureau of
Equal Educational Opportunity.
(2) The
School Committee shall respond promptly, but no later than 30 days, in writing
to the complaining party. The School Committee shall also send a copy of its
response to the Bureau of Equal Educational Opportunity.
(3) The
Bureau of Equal Educational Opportunity shall act as the representative of the
Board of Education for the purpose of receiving complaints pursuant to 603 CMR
26.00.
(4) The
Bureau of Equal Educational Opportunity shall, pursuant to a complaint received
under 603 CMR 26.09 (1) or on its own initiative, conduct reviews to insure
compliance with M.G.L. c. 76 s. 5 and 603 CMR 26.00 The School Committee and the
specific school(s) involved shall cooperate to the fullest extent with such
review.
(5) In the
event of non-compliance with M.G.L. c. 76 s. 5 or 603 CMR 26.00 the Board of
Education may take such action as it sees fit, including, but not limited to,
withholding of funds or referral of the matter to the Office of the Attorney
General for appropriate legal action.
Private Right of
Enforcement
Nothing in 603
CMR 26.00 shall abridge or in any way limit the right of a parent, guardian, or
person affected to seek enforcement of St. 1971, c.622 in any court or
administrative agency of competent jurisdiction.
